Common Faucet Repair Issues in Sacramento Homes
Homeowners in Sacramento often encounter a variety of faucet problems. These can include persistent drips, low water pressure, difficulty turning the handle, corrosion, and even entirely broken fixtures. The warm Sacramento climate and the mineral content in local water can sometimes contribute to wear and tear on faucet mechanisms. Recognizing these issues is the first step toward finding a solution.
Expert plumbers typically address these issues through a range of services:
- Leak Detection and Repair: Identifying the source of the leak, whether it’s a worn-out washer, a faulty O-ring, or a damaged cartridge, and replacing the defective component.
- Handle and Spout Repair: Addressing loose handles, cracked spouts, or internal mechanisms that prevent the faucet from operating smoothly.
- Cartridge Replacement: The cartridge is a crucial component in most modern faucets. When it malfunctions, it can lead to leaks or operational problems.
- Washer and Seal Replacement: For older compression faucets, worn-out rubber washers are a common cause of drips.
- Corrosion and Mineral Buildup Removal: Sacramento’s water can sometimes lead to mineral buildup, which professionals can safely clean and address.
- Faucet Replacement: In cases where a faucet is beyond repair or you wish to upgrade, professionals can expertly replace your existing fixture.

The process typically begins with a diagnostic assessment to pinpoint the root cause of the faucet malfunction. This often involves disassembling the faucet to inspect internal parts. Common materials used for repairs include high-quality replacement cartridges, durable O-rings and washers made from materials like rubber or silicone, and new valve seats.
For instance, if you’re in the Arden-Arcade area and have a leaky kitchen faucet, a plumber might find that a worn-out O-ring inside the handle is the culprit. They would then carefully remove the old part, clean the surrounding area, and install a new, precisely sized O-ring to restore proper function. Similarly, in a residential property near Discovery Park, a plumber might encounter a corroded valve seat in a bathroom faucet, necessitating its replacement to stop an persistent drip.
Professionals utilize specialized tools designed for faucet repair, ensuring minimal disruption to your plumbing system. Their expertise extends to various faucet types, including compression, cartridge, ball, and ceramic-disk faucets, common in homes across Sacramento and its surrounding areas.

Q2: How do I know if my faucet needs repair or replacement?
A2: Persistent leaks, significantly reduced water flow, unusual noises, or visible damage such as cracks or rust are strong indicators that your faucet needs attention. If repairs become frequent, or if the fixture is very old and shows signs of extensive wear, replacement might be a more cost-effective long-term solution. A professional plumber can accurately assess the condition of your faucet.
